A college here with no first-year number is not reporting art history separately, so there is no admit rate for the major to read and the campus decision is the one that applies. At the UC campuses the row shows what happened to students who named art history on the application rather than a decision made by an art history department, and the reported rates run from 9% at UCLA to 88% at UC Riverside. Admits are not enrollees. At most UC programs students are admitted to the campus, not the major. This page as JSON → · Back to the 22 California colleges →

Sources: UC Information Center ↗ (first-year applicants and admits by major); CSU Chancellor's Office ↗ (applications and admissions by major, first-time freshman and transfer; groups under 10 suppressed); federal College Scorecard field-of-study data (earnings, debt); IPEDS (admit rate, net price, cost of attendance). A program that admits few students is not always harder for a given applicant — it is usually a program that receives far more applications than it has seats.
